During a panoramic Vltava river cruise, you can expect to see several of Prague's most famous sights. These include the historic Charles Bridge, the sprawling complex of Prague Castle and St. Vitus Cathedral, the stunning National Theatre, the unique Dancing House, and various charming buildings along the Old Town and Lesser Town riverbanks.

Vltava river cruises in Prague generally operate throughout the day, from morning until evening. Evening cruises are popular for experiencing the city's illuminated skyline. Operating hours and frequency can vary by season, with more extensive schedules usually available during the warmer months.
Yes, Prague offers various types of Vltava river cruises beyond the standard panoramic option. You can find longer cruises that include lunch or dinner, romantic evening cruises, or shorter, themed historical boat trips focusing on specific parts of the river or city. Each type offers a distinct experience with varying inclusions and durations.
Many panoramic Vltava river cruises, especially those lasting around an hour, often include a complimentary welcome drink, which might be an aperitif or a non-alcoholic beverage. Some cruises also offer informative audio commentary available in multiple languages, enriching your journey with historical and cultural insights about the passing landmarks.
